  Women's Sports Foundation ATHLETES
Anna DeForge was fourth in the WNBA in three-point shooting and a finalist for the WNBA's most improved player.
DeForge was the first woman from the University of Nebraska to earn a spot on a WNBA roster.
In 1998, DeForge was named to the WNIT Final Four All-Tournament Team and scored double figures in 49 consecutive games from her junior to senior years in college.

 Anna DeForge -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Anna Louise DeForge (born on April 14, 1976 in Iron Mountain, Michigan) is an American professional basketball player who most recently plays for the Indiana Fever in the Women's National Basketball Association (WNBA).
Born to Rosemary and Roger DeForge, she played at Niagara High School in Niagara, Wisconsin.
DeForge majored in Business Administration at the University of Nebraska.

 DeForge traded to Indiana   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-07)
The Mercury made the first trade of the Paul Westhead era Friday, dealing Anna DeForge to the Indiana Fever for Kelly Miller in an exchange of guards.
DeForge, who started 94 games in the past three seasons for the Mercury, was a restricted free agent who had an offer from the Fever.
The 5-10 DeForge, 29, averaged 13.1 points in her Mercury career and was third in the 2003 Most Improved Player voting.

 WNBA.com: Working Out With... Anna DeForge
When she went undrafted after graduating in 1998, guard Anna DeForge did not give up.
She got her first crack at the WNBA in 2000 as a member of the Detroit Shock, but settled in as a starter with the Phoenix Mercury in 2003.
Over the past two seasons, DeForge has established herself as one of the top shooters in the league and makes up one of the most potent scoring backcourts.
